The Perfect Way to Start Your Summer

A combination of bootcamp and a rejuvenating spa treatment is just what the doctor ordered…

A day spent rejuvenating at Powerscourt Hotel Resort & Spa, taking in those breathtaking Sugarloaf views, is the undisputed antidote to cure whatever’s ailing you. Just last weekend, we were invited to make the half an hour journey (it’s literally on our doorstep) down to Wicklow to try out their latest summer offering; Beachbody Bootcamp.

Before you run for the hills, let us remind you that the bootcamp aspect is followed swiftly by a gorgeous lunch (which we enjoyed in the comfort of our fluffy spa robes), complete use of their luxurious spa facilities and a 1 hour and 50 minute detoxifying body ritual. Though it might be the relaxing treatment that has you most excited, the bootcamp with Sam was all kinds of fun.

At 11.30am, we had braced ourselves for an hour of pure torture, but it was anything but. Sam’s bootcamp circuit took place on the stunning lawns of the hotel, the sun was shining, the fountain was dancing quietly in front of us and the workout was totally invigorating. After an enjoyable mix of kettle bells, flipping tires and bodyweight exercises, we had well and truly earned our treatment. Sam is encouraging, attentive and inspiring.

After our luxury personal training session, it was off to the spa for lunch. Suffice to say, despite being only a half an hour from the city, it felt as though we were a world away from the hustle and bustle. Their warm and friendly staff catered to our every need before guiding us towards the most tranquil pool area we’ve ever experienced. With low, relaxing lighting and perfectly warm waters, you’ll be hard pushed to pull yourself away, but luckily with this particular package, you’ve got your detoxifying treatment to look forward to.

Using the best of ESPA products, this unforgettable treatment combines a body wrap and massage to detoxify the body and restore balance. ?Following a body exfoliation, a detoxifying algae is applied, and the scalp is gently massaged. ?Then it was straight into a hot shower to wash away the algae, followed by a detoxifying aromatherapy massage, during which this writer fell into the deepest of slumbers.

If it’s the nicest way to ease you into your summer health kick that you’re after, complete with a little luxury, we couldn’t recommend this enough. Where else would you get a world class treatment that goes on for almost 2 hours, a personal training session on the lawns of a 5 star luxury resort, a three course lunch AND unlimited use of an amazing spa for €155 per person?
